Introduction

The Central Depository Services (India) Limited (CDSL) plays a pivotal role in the Indian capital market by providing depository services. To comply with regulatory requirements and ensure the integrity of the market, CDSL mandates its participants to undergo a Know Your Customer (KYC) process. This guide provides comprehensive information on the CDSL KYC status check, its significance, and practical steps for participants.

Significance of CDSL KYC Status Check

KYC verification is essential for several reasons:

  • Compliance with Regulations: CDSL and market regulators require participants to maintain up-to-date KYC information to comply with anti-money laundering (AML) and combating the financing of terrorism (CFT) regulations.
  • Risk Mitigation: Conducting KYC checks helps depositories identify and mitigate risks associated with potential fraudulent activities or identity theft.
  • Investor Protection: KYC ensures that investors are adequately identified and protected from financial scams or misuse of their personal information.
  • Transparency and Accountability: KYC processes enhance transparency within the market system, ensuring that participants are known and accountable for their actions.

CDSL KYC Status Check Process

1. Entity Registration and Verification

First, participants must register with CDSL and provide relevant documentation for verification. This includes:

  • Certificate of Incorporation or Registration
  • Proof of Address
  • Director or Authorized Signatory Details

2. KYC Form Submission

Once registration is complete, participants submit a KYC form (KYC-CSD) to CDSL. The form requires detailed information about the participant, including:

  • Business Activities
  • Beneficial Owners
  • Source of Funds
  • Declaration and Undertaking

3. Document Submission

Along with the KYC form, participants must submit supporting documents for validation, such as:

  • Identity Proof (Passport, Voter ID, PAN Card)
  • Address Proof (Utility Bills, Rental Agreement)

4. CDSL Verification

CDSL reviews the KYC form and supporting documents to verify the participant's identity and information. This process may involve cross-checking with government databases and other sources.

5. KYC Status Generation

Upon successful verification, CDSL assigns a KYC status to the participant. The status can be either Verified or Non-Verified.

CDSL KYC Status Check for Participants

Participants can check their KYC status through the CDSL website using the following steps:

  1. Visit the CDSL website (www.cdslindia.com)
  2. Click on "Participant's Login"
  3. Enter your User ID and Password
  4. Navigate to "KYC Status Check"
  5. Enter the relevant details (Participant Code, KYC Reference Number)

Benefits of CDSL KYC Status Check

  • Verifying KYC ensures compliance with regulations and reduces the risk of non-compliance penalties.
  • It establishes a reliable database of market participants, promoting transparency and confidence.
  • KYC verification facilitates smoother account opening and trading processes for both participants and investors.
  • By reducing fraud and financial crime, KYC safeguards the integrity of the capital market.

Consequences of Non-Compliance

Participants who fail to maintain a valid KYC status may face consequences, including:

  • Restrictions on account opening and trading activities
  • Suspension or termination of depository services
  • Legal action for non-compliance with regulatory obligations

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Is KYC status verification mandatory for all CDSL participants?

Yes, all CDSL participants must maintain a valid KYC status.

2. How frequently should KYC status be updated?

KYC status should be updated as soon as any material change occurs, such as a change in address or beneficial ownership.

3. What happens if a participant's KYC status is non-verified?

Participants with non-verified KYC status may face restrictions or suspension of services until the verification is completed.

4. How can participants check their KYC status?

Participants can check their KYC status through the CDSL website using the "KYC Status Check" option.

5. Is KYC status verification a one-time process?

No, KYC status verification is an ongoing process, and participants must ensure their information remains up-to-date.

6. What are the consequences of failing to comply with KYC requirements?

Non-compliance can result in penalties, suspension of services, or legal action.
